https://t.co/QkFe8trWDx It walks! Together with the Akhmanova lab we provide in vitro and in vivo evidence that MKLP2 is a motile kinesin that transports the CPC along microtubules. CPC binding makes the motor more processive. @oncodeinstitute @pjzvh @UMCU_CMM @ProgramUmc

Hadders et al @UMCUtrecht demonstrate that the kinases Haspin and Bub1 recruit separate pools of Aurora B to #centromeres of human cells https://t.co/YMPr6trHbr
